Why watering daily is killing your Phoenix lawn (and the 3-day fix).

Phoenix lawn with floating paver walkway and healthy turf

Every summer we take over customers who watered their lawn every single day for a decade, and can't figure out why their grass finally died. It's the same conversation on the same driveway, in the same 110-degree afternoon. They point at the brown patches. They tell us the controller is set to 15 minutes, every zone, every morning. They ask what's wrong with the water in Phoenix.

Nothing's wrong with the water. Something's wrong with the schedule.

Daily watering makes roots lazy.

Grass grows roots toward moisture. When water shows up every single morning, roots never have a reason to dive — they stay in the top two inches of soil where the sprinkler puts them. Those shallow roots are fine in April. They're fine in October. They're not fine in July, when the top two inches of a Phoenix yard hit 130°F by noon and stay there.

The lawn browns. You crank the daily runtime from 15 minutes to 25. It browns faster. Now the shallow roots are drowning and baking. One summer haboob knocks out your controller for three days and the whole lawn is toast — because there were never any deep roots to hold on with.

The 3-day fix: deep, infrequent, cycle-and-soak.

Three days a week. Not four. Not seven. Three. And when you water, water long enough that moisture reaches 6–12 inches down. That's where roots need to be for the lawn to survive a Phoenix summer without your controller holding its hand every morning.

Runtime depends on head type. This is the part most people get wrong:

  • Spray heads (~40 gph per 1,000 sq ft): 8–10 minutes on, 30–60 minutes off, then run again. Two cycles per watering day.
  • Rotors (~15–25 gph per 1,000 sq ft): 20–30 minutes per cycle, 1–2 cycles.
  • R-VAN and rotary nozzles (matched precip, ~0.6 in/hr): 12–15 minutes per cycle, two cycles.
Cycle-and-soak — the "off" period matters as much as the "on." Phoenix caliche has almost zero intake rate. A single 30-minute run just sheets off into the street. Break it into short cycles with a soak between and the same total water actually reaches the roots.

How to know if it's working.

Push a long screwdriver into the lawn a few hours after watering. It should slide in easily to 6 inches. If it stops at 2 inches, your cycles are too short. If the yard has standing water when the cycle ends, they're too long.

Give it three weeks. The lawn will look a little rough transitioning — shallow roots die back as deep ones take over. Then it turns a corner. By month two, you'll notice you can skip a watering day during a cool spell without the yard flinching. That's what deep roots buy you.

Kurapia and Tahoma: the drought-tolerant turf alternatives most Phoenix homeowners haven't heard of.

Modern Phoenix pool deck with pavers and drought-tolerant lawn area

A customer in Arcadia called last spring wanting to rip out her Bermuda because her August water bill hit $340 and she was tired of overseeding rye every October to keep the yard green through winter. She didn't want rock. She wanted something soft the dog could lie on. She'd talked to two other landscapers and both had quoted her synthetic turf.

Synthetic wasn't wrong. But nobody had mentioned Kurapia or Tahoma. Most homeowners haven't heard of either one, and most landscapers don't install them. We install both, and for the right yard they're the answer.

What they are.

Kurapia is a low-growing perennial groundcover — a sterile variety of Lippia nodiflora — that behaves like turf but uses roughly 60% less water than Bermuda once established. It stays 1–2 inches tall without mowing (though you can mow it if you want a manicured look). Its roots go down 6–10 feet, which is what makes it survive Phoenix on a fraction of the water. It flowers small white blooms in summer and pollinators love it. It handles moderate foot traffic.

Tahoma 31 is a Bermuda hybrid developed at Oklahoma State specifically for drought tolerance and cold hardiness. It uses about 20% less water than standard Bermuda, greens up two weeks earlier in spring, holds color two weeks later in fall, and takes hard foot traffic (kids, dogs, backyard football). It looks and feels like premium Bermuda — because it is — just with a better water profile.

When each one fits.

Kurapia is right when: the yard is mostly visual (front yard, side yard, courtyard), the family doesn't need a play surface, and the water bill matters. It's also great as a filler between pavers or along a pool deck where traditional turf gets ratty from splash-out.

Tahoma is right when: you actually use your yard — dogs, kids, entertaining — and you want a real lawn that acts like one, just with lower water demand. It's the choice for backyards. It's also our default recommendation over standard Bermuda for any new install.

Turf's not the enemy — turf without a plan is. A 1,000 sq ft Kurapia lawn uses less water than 250 sq ft of Bermuda. Right species, right zone, right heads, and lawn stops being the water villain.

What the install looks like.

Both start with a proper sub-base — 4 inches of screened topsoil over the native caliche, laser-graded so water drains where you want it. Kurapia goes in as plugs on 12-inch centers and fills in over 8–10 weeks; Tahoma goes down as sod and looks like a finished lawn the day we're done. Both get water-efficient heads (R-VAN or matched-precip rotary nozzles on the perimeter, drip under the paver edges) on a smart controller programmed for the species.

Kurapia zones run about 12 minutes per cycle, two cycles per watering day, three days a week in summer, dropping to twice a week in shoulder season and once a week in winter. Tahoma runs a little longer — closer to Bermuda schedules but at 80% of the volume.

Real installs, real yards.

The Arcadia yard we opened this piece with is 1,800 sq ft of Kurapia now, in the second summer. It's soft, it flowers a little in June, the dog naps on it, and her August water bill this year was $187. She still can't get over the drop.

A Paradise Valley backyard we put in last spring is 3,200 sq ft of Tahoma 31 wrapping a pool. The homeowner had two Bermuda installs die on him in ten years. The Tahoma came in thick, took the traffic from two teenagers and a lab, and held color through a mild winter without overseeding.
